Changes to Google in the recent months have been groundbreaking…

  • Caffine – One of the biggest shake-ups ever to happen to how Google ranks websites
  • Integration with Twitter
  • Live search options now dominant on every search page – just have a look on the left of any Google search results.

Google: New Search Options & Social Media

  • Do you have a blog? If not, you will never be found in the Blog results.
  • Do you have any content update areas to your site where visitors can interact? Perhaps a forum? If not, you will never be found in the Discussions results.
  • Do you publish articles that could be included in Google News? If not, you will never be found in Google News results.
  • Do you use Twitter on a regular basis? If not, then you will never be seen in the up-to-the-second results that are fed into Google. A wonderful branding opportunity that many miss altogether.

By definition, Social Media is the distribution of information and media through ‘social’ networks. This can be a following built up by yourself (e.g. LinkedIn, Facebook), or via more viral means where people want to re-publish what you have to say (e.g. Twitter, Digg, etc).

However, you have to have something that people wish to follow or re-distribute, so you are back to a good website and rich, interesting content.

This is an ever expanding spiral now! The more content you have, the more people will follow and re-distribute what you have to say.
